What does Guy Palmer argue?
Almost half ethnic minority children live in low income households compared to a quarter white children
2x more likely to be unemployed
3x free school meals
What is a criticism of Guy Palmer?
Swann Report found that even those Indian and Chinese are materially deprived do better than most
What does Rex argue?
Racial discrimination leads to worsened poverty through societal exclusion
What is an example of worsened poverty through racial discrimination?
Awaab Ishak died of black mould in house
What did Wood find in his study?
Sent applications to 1000 job vacancies
1 in 16 ethnic minority names got interview
1 in 9 white names
What do Bereitier and Engelmann argue?
Language spoken by low income black American families is inadequate for succes
What did Driver and Ballard find?
Asian children were as good at English by 16
What do Archer and Francis argue?
Emphasis on education has led to an Asian work ethic
What is the Asian work ethic?
Having a stronger drive to work as parental attitudes force child into working harder from a young age
What does Lupton argue?
Close knit families - high expectations and authority
What is a criticism of close knit families?
Bangladeshi and Pakistani children also have close knit families but underperform
What does Murray argue?
Matrifocal lone parent black families leads to poor educational achievement because of lack of discipline
What is a criticism of Murray?
Mothers can be a powerful role model and there is no significant correlation
What does Sewell argue?
Lack of fatherly nurturing leads to anti school black masculinity where educational achievement is seen as selling out to the white establishment (peer pressure)
What is a criticism of Sewell?
Gillborn - black underachievement is due to institutional racism

What does Gillborn argue?
Myth of black challenge
Asian ideal students
What is myth of the black challenge?
Black pupils are more likely to be disciplined for the same behaviour which leads to self-fulfilling prophecy
What does Gillborn argue about Asian pupils?
Teachers view them as the ideal students because of their positive attitude to school
What is a criticism of Asian ideal students and who argued it?
Cecile Wright - teachers labelled Asian culture as inferior and assumed they had a poor grasp on English

What are liberal chauvinists>
Teachers who believe black pupils are culturally deprived
What are overt racists?
Teachers who believe whites are superior
What are colour blind teachers?
Those that see no problem as all pupils are equal
Were black girls pro or anti school according to Mirza?
Anti school, pro education
What does Coard argue?
Ethnocentric curriculum
How does the ethnocentric curriculum disadvantage ethnic minorities?
Undermines self esteem
What is a criticism of ethnocentric curriculum?
Curriculum ignores Asians yet they perform better
